I'm still looking for a Group-31 battery for my truck. Seems like companies don't want to sell them anymore. I went to a local battery shop and their Group-31 battery was only 850 CCA which made no sense to me. They must have extra thick plastic case to avoid spending money on lead. Seems like everything is going that way nowadays.

I've been running the Kirkland brand batteries through Costco for years now in all my vehicles. They pro-rate their batteries on warranty, and only once have I had to return a bad battery at the 3-4 year mark, I usually get 6-7 years out of each battery.
